Will there be a fourth stimulus check? – Caro Federal Credit Union (2024)

A group of lawmakers is starting to call for the fourth round of stimulus checks, just as the final payments from the third round are starting to hit mailboxes.

On March 30th, a few U.S. Senators wrote a letter asking President Biden to consider both recurring direct payments as well as automatic unemployment insurance extensions as part of his Build Back Better economic plan.

Also known as the American Jobs Plan, the bill doesn’t yet mention a fourth stimulus check similar to those millions have received throughout the pandemic. Rather, it’s a long-term initiative to rescue, recover and rebuild the country’s financial standing.

In short, President Biden has not indicated publicly that he supports a fourth stimulus payment, rather, he is focused on passing the Build Back Better plan that aims to improve transportation infrastructure and affordable housing, among other things.
